Fannie Mae Form 1025: Small Residential Income Appraisal Report. This report is used for appraising 2- to 4-unit residential income properties, and includes an interior and exterior inspection of the subject property.
There are four home appraisal types for the mortgage loan process. The four types are the full appraisal, exterior-only appraisal, the rental analysis, and the broker price opinion. A full appraisal is the most common type of appraisal.
Description: The Single Family Comparable Rent Schedule Form 1007 is intended to provide an appraiser with a familiar format to estimate the market rent of a property. Adjustments should be made only for those items of significant difference between the comparables and the subject property.
This report form is designed to report an appraisal of the cooperative interest (the cooperative shares or other evidence of an ownership interest in the cooperative corporation and the accompanying occupancy rights) in a cooperative project or the cooperative interest in a planned unit development (PUD).
An Individual Condominium Unit Appraisal Report (ICUAR) is for appraisals of one-unit properties in condo projects based on interior and exterior property inspections. Also known as Fannie Mae Form 1073, appraisals reported on this form must be completed in accordance with the UAD Specification.

A URAR form, also known as Fannie Mae Form 1004, contains information needed to complete a full appraisal of a property using three primary approaches to determine value: cost approach, sales comparison approach and income approach.
File # Page 1 of 6. Fannie Mae Form 2095 March 2005. The purpose of this summary appraisal report is to provide the lender/client with an accurate, and adequately supported, opinion of the market value of the subject property.
